Fine Bronze Ring. Dogon Culture, Mali

This fine Dogon equestrian figurative ring depicts the rider seated in an upright position, with a elongated and exaggerated body in relation to size of the animal he rides. The rider is shown resting a title staff on his shoulder and the body of the circular ring displays fine cross-hatched decorations. Over time the surface has developed a beautifully deep, encrusted verdigris surface patina.

Estimated Period: 19th Century

Ex Private Collection, France

Height (Incl. Base): 14cm

Width (Incl. Base): 5cm
